Bodyworlds exhibition

I went to the world famous bodyworlds exhibition on the weekend. It involves a process called plastination where bodies are preserved have a look at . It was fascinating but also quite gruesome as you remembered that these were real people once. The most shocking was a pregnant women who had her stomach opened and you could see the unborn foetus inside. This was topped by a man and woman having sex. Other highlights included smokers ling, heart disease, a hip replacement, fracture repairs, enlarged livers and a stomach and spleen on display. It was fascinating to the nerves, muscles and blood supplies of the body clearly on display. A must for all anatomy students.

neck pain

Well this week has certainly been one for neck pain. I have been chatting to Rupert the chiropractor at C1 and he too has noticed a sudden increase in people coming for treatment for neck pain. All the necks have been the old favourite levator scapulae plus trapezius muscles solid as a rock. If you work at a computer in a fixed position staring at a screen then you need to move and stretch to avoid problems, its that simple.
